WebWhat are the Steps to Dividing Fractions? The following steps have to be followed in order to divide fractions: Step 1: Take the reciprocal of the second fraction. Step 2: Multiply it with the first fraction. Step 3: … WebSo in other words, you can read it as 3 + 5/6.
